#e8c5b6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e8c5b6 is composed of 91% red, 77.3% green and 71.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.1% magenta, 21.6%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 18 degrees, a saturation of 52.1% and a lightness of 81.2%. #e8c5b6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d18b6d.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

Shades and Tints of #e8c5b6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fbf4f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e8c5b6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d2cecc is the less saturated color, while #febca0 is the most saturated one.
